Resorts World continues to emerge as one of the Strip’s most vegan-friendly hotels. FUHU bolsters the vegan options at Las Vegas hotel, thanks to their handful of dishes.

The gorgeous dining room featuring retro touches and Chinese-inspired murals, as well as a lush patio, make this the perfect spot for contemporary Asian cuisine. A concept from Zouk Singapore, which includes an adjacent night club of the same name FUHU offers up a vegan-friendly menu.

Las Vegas Vegan-Friendly Restaurant: FUHU

Vegan appetizers at FUHU

There are two vegan appetizers at FUHU. First, there is the vegan chicken larb. This dish features Gardein chicken in a lemongrass rice powder with onions. It’s tossed in a citrus vinaigrette and served with lettuce cups.

Second is a vegan sushi roll. The Vegan Two Timing Tuna is made with negi tempura and ponzu caramelized onion and topped with thin slices of roasted red pepper.

If you want something a little more basic, you can request an avocado and cucumber roll.

Next, let’s tackle the salads. The kale salad is vegan and comes with shaved walnuts, cucumber and crispy yuba in a truffle vinaigrette.

Vegan sides at FUHU 

There are handful which can be made vegan when it comes to vegan sides at FUHU.

First, their signature fried rice is a beauty, but you’ve got to request it. Cooked with beets, the vibrant magenta rice comes with veggies. Request it without the egg to make it vegan.

Other dishes that can be made vegan are the noodles (available on request), eggplant chili, lo mein, broccolini, and green beans and garlic.

Vegan main courses

Our favorite dish at FUHU is the vegan Basil Beef. The perfectly cooked Impossible beef is joined by basil, onions, beech shrooms and peppers.

Second, there’s a roasted cauliflower. If you’re a fan of cauliflower, this dish is for you. It’s a massive chop of roasted cauliflower, topped with raw cauliflower and in an onion marmalade. The dish also has keffir lime and comes topped with toasted peanuts.

Finally, there’s roasted mushroom and carrots in a green curry and topped with eggplant caviar.

The District at Resorts World, S. Las Vegas Blvd., Las Vegas, 89109; 702-676-7740; Mon. – Thurs.: 5 p.m. – 11 p.m.; Fri. – Sat.: 5 p.m. – midnight; Sun.: midnight – noon, 5 p.m. – midnight
